Understanding Value and Market Discrepancies
At the heart of successful sports betting lies the concept of value. Value exists when the odds offered by a bookmaker are higher than your own assessment of the true probability of an event occurring. Identifying these discrepancies is crucial. This isn’t about predicting the future with certainty, it's about recognizing when the market has undervalued or overvalued a particular outcome. A fundamental aspect of value betting is developing your own independent probability assessments. This involves a comprehensive analysis of team form, player statistics, head-to-head records, and any other relevant factors that could influence the outcome of an event. Don’t rely solely on the opinions of others – formulate your own conclusions.
The Role of Statistical Analysis
Statistical analysis plays a vital role in determining value. Modern sports generate a wealth of data, providing a rich source of information for bettors. Analyzing key performance indicators (KPIs) can reveal hidden trends and patterns that might not be immediately apparent. For example, in football, looking beyond goals scored and conceded to examine expected goals (xG) can provide a more nuanced understanding of a team’s attacking and defensive capabilities. Similarly, in basketball, tracking advanced stats like true shooting percentage and assist ratio can offer valuable insights. The goal is to use data to refine your probability assessments and identify opportunities where the market is mispricing outcomes. Remember that statistical models are only as good as the data they are based on, so ensure your sources are reliable and up-to-date.
| Football | xG (Expected Goals), Possession %, Shots on Target | Assessing attacking threat and defensive solidity. |
| Basketball | True Shooting %, Assist Ratio, Rebound Rate | Evaluating offensive efficiency and overall team performance. |
| Tennis | Ace %, First Serve %, Break Point Conversion Rate | Predicting success on serve and return. |
| Baseball | ERA (Earned Run Average), OPS (On-Base Plus Slugging) | Gauging pitching effectiveness and hitting prowess. |
Utilizing these kinds of statistical metrics allows for a deeper understanding beyond surface-level observations, fostering a more informed betting approach.
Effective Bankroll Management Strategies
Disciplined bankroll management is arguably as important as identifying value. Without a solid system for managing your funds, even the most astute bettors can quickly deplete their resources. A common guideline is to risk only 1-5% of your bankroll on any single bet. This helps to mitigate the impact of losing bets and ensures that you have sufficient funds to weather losing streaks. It's also crucial to avoid chasing losses. The temptation to increase your stake in an attempt to recoup previous losses is a common mistake that can lead to further financial setbacks. Stick to your pre-defined staking plan and avoid emotional betting decisions. Consistency is paramount. Regularly reviewing your betting records will help you identify areas for improvement and fine-tune your bankroll management strategy.
The Kelly Criterion and Fractional Kelly
For those seeking a more mathematically rigorous approach, the Kelly Criterion offers a method for determining optimal bet size based on your perceived edge. The formula calculates the percentage of your bankroll you should wager to maximize long-term growth. However, the full Kelly Criterion can be quite aggressive, particularly when your perceived edge is high. Therefore, many bettors opt for a fractional Kelly approach, wagering a smaller percentage of the calculated Kelly stake. This provides a more conservative and sustainable strategy, reducing the risk of significant drawdowns. The key is to find the right balance between maximizing potential returns and preserving your capital. Using a spreadsheet or online calculator can help you implement the Kelly Criterion or fractional Kelly effectively.

Understanding Different Betting Markets
Beyond the traditional win-draw-win markets, a wide array of betting options exist, each with its own unique characteristics and potential for value. Exploring these different markets can open up new opportunities for profitable betting. Over/Under markets, for example, focus on the total number of goals, points, or other quantifiable events in a game. Handicap betting (also known as spread betting) levels the playing field between unevenly matched teams, offering more competitive odds. Prop bets (proposition bets) allow you to wager on specific events within a game, such as a player scoring a touchdown or a team achieving a certain number of corner kicks. Understanding the nuances of each market is essential for identifying value and making informed betting decisions.
The Benefits of Specialization
While it’s tempting to bet on a wide range of sports and markets, specialization can be a highly effective strategy. Focusing on a particular sport or league allows you to develop a deeper understanding of the teams, players, and dynamics at play. This increased knowledge can give you a significant edge over more casual bettors. The more you immerse yourself in a specific area, the better equipped you will be to identify value and make informed decisions. If you are passionate about tennis, for example, dedicating your attention to that sport is likely to yield better results than spreading your bets across multiple disciplines. It allows for focused research and in-depth analysis.

Leveraging Technology and Tools
Modern technology offers a wealth of tools to assist sports bettors. From statistical analysis software to odds comparison websites, these resources can significantly enhance your research and decision-making process. Odds comparison sites allow you to quickly compare odds from multiple bookmakers, ensuring you get the best possible value for your bets. Betting tracking apps help you monitor your results, analyze your performance, and identify areas for improvement. Social media can also be a valuable source of information, providing insights from other bettors and experts. However, be mindful of the information you consume, and always verify its accuracy before making any betting decisions.
